    In the world of fan-made gaming mods and community history, the story of Counter-Strike: Source 2.5

    is one of evolution and nostalgia. It represents a bridge between the classic gameplay of Counter-Strike: Source and the modernized aesthetic of Counter-Strike: Global Offensive. The Origin: A Bridge Between Eras

    In the early 2010s, as the community moved toward Global Offensive, a group of modders and fans felt that the original Source engine still had untapped potential. The "2.5" designation was never an official Valve release but rather a community-driven project. The goal was simple: take the rock-solid mechanics of Source—which many veterans preferred for its movement and hitboxes—and "backport" the high-definition weapon models, skins, and UI elements from the newer CS:GO. The Rise of the "2.5" Mod

    The mod became a cult classic for players with lower-end PCs who couldn't smoothly run CS:GO but wanted the updated visual flair. It featured:

    Modernized Arsenals: Iconic skins like the Dragon Lore or Asimov appearing in the Source engine.

    Enhanced Textures: Re-baked maps that looked sharper while maintaining the original layout.

    Integrated Servers: A dedicated community that hosted "v2.5" specific servers, creating a niche competitive scene. The "FitGirl" Connection

    The mention of a FitGirl Repack for such a mod is a testament to the mod's massive popularity within the community. FitGirl is well-known for highly compressed installers of mainstream games. When a community mod like Counter-Strike: Source 2.5 receives a repack, it usually signifies that the mod has reached a "standalone" status—essentially becoming its own full-fledged game client that includes all the necessary patches, maps, and skins in one small, easy-to-install package. The Legacy

    Today, Counter-Strike: Source 2.5 serves as a digital time capsule. It represents an era where the community refused to let an older engine die, instead choosing to "skin" it into the future. For many, it remains the definitive way to experience the Source engine with a modern coat of paint, preserved by the very archivists and repackers who keep niche gaming history alive.

    There is no official release of " Counter-Strike: Source 2.5

    " from Valve, and consequently, there is no legitimate FitGirl Repack for such a version. The primary games in this series are Counter-Strike: Source (released in 2004) and its successor, Counter-Strike 2 (released in 2023).

    "Counter-Strike Source 2.5" appears to be a fan-made modification or "mod pack" rather than an official sequel or update. Understanding Counter-Strike: Source 2.5

    The term "2.5" usually refers to community-driven projects that attempt to modernize the classic Counter-Strike: Source experience without moving to the Counter-Strike 2 engine. These modifications often include:

    Visual Overhauls: Upgraded high-definition textures for maps and player models.

    Weapon Skins: Porting modern skins from CS:GO or CS2 into the older engine.

    Enhanced Sound: Reworked audio for gunfire, footsteps, and environment effects.

    Custom Maps: Community-created versions of classic maps like Dust II, Mirage, and Inferno. Important Security Warning

    While there is no official game called " Counter Strike Source 2.5 ," this typically refers to a highly modded version of Counter-Strike: Source designed to look and feel like CS:GO or CS2. 🎯 Review of Counter-Strike: Source (Modded)

    Visuals & Physics: The Source engine is praised for its interactive physics (like moving barrels) and fun ragdoll effects that some feel are superior to modern titles.

    Movement: Many veteran players prefer the "looser" movement, bunny hopping, and surfing mechanics in Source compared to the more "sterile" feel of CS:GO.

    Bot Support: It features excellent bot support, making it a top choice for offline play if you cannot access official servers.

    Performance: It runs exceptionally well on older hardware where CS2 or even CS:GO might struggle.

    Community Mods: The "2.5" community mods often include updated weapon skins, player models, and modern UI elements to bridge the gap between old and new. 🛠️ FitGirl Repack Features
